UCLA Steals Another One, Beats Cal 81-80
This is almost laughable it’s so bad. UCLA once again had victory snatched from the jaws of defeat, with another bad officiating call at the end of the UCLA/Cal game, giving the Bruins another win in a game that they deserved to lose.
While Kevin Love made a sick three to bring the Bruins to within one; the controversy occurred on the following inbounds play. With seconds left in the game, the officials ignored a clear UCLA hack on a deflection, and instead ruled a turnover, giving the Bruins the ball back. From there, Josh Shipp was able to make a circus shot with 1.5 seconds left to give the Bruins the win.
